Job Advert: Quality Technician We are currently seeking a Quality Technician to join our team on a temp-to-perm basis. As a Quality Technician, you will be responsible for carrying out all practical work relating to Quality Control. Your role will involve testing ingredients and finished products, conducting organoleptic testing, ensuring compliance with quality and food safety criteria, and releasing ingredients and finished products based on confirmed compliance. To excel in this role, you should have a good understanding of the role of Quality in the food industry and possess excellent attention to detail and accuracy. Teamwork and communication skills are essential, as you will be working closely with other team members, customers, and suppliers. Previous experience in the flavour industry and knowledge/experience of using internal IT/LIMS databases systems are highly desirable. However, full training will be provided, and we encourage candidates with a background in the food industry, particularly in a quality role, to apply. Key Responsibilities: Plan and carry out all quality tests in accordance with Quality Control test methods and procedures. Thoroughly check all results obtained from analyses against specifications. Communicate any non-conformance to the relevant parties and recommend necessary corrective actions. Record and store all test results and additional data in an easily accessible manner. Release finished products and raw materials on the AX system, ensuring correct paperwork. Complete retest programmes, arrange micro samples, and follow up with suppliers regarding non-conformances. Conduct internal factory audits and support in the investigation of customer complaints. Suggest improvements in equipment, techniques, and evaluation based on day-to-day operations. Requirements: Understanding of the role of Quality in the food industry. Good attention to detail and accuracy. Teamwork and communication skills. Previous experience in the flavour industry (highly desirable). Knowledge/experience of using internal IT/LIMS databases systems (highly desirable). Knowledge of the food industry, particularly in a quality role (full training will be provided). Ability to work safely and observe company and departmental safety rules. Strong organisational skills and the ability to prioritise tasks effectively. Flexibility to adapt to changing priorities and work in a fast-paced environment.
